Whack The Creeps
Whack The Creeps is a point-and-click Flash game with a simple premise. You’re relaxing at a bar with your boyfriend, and he needs to use the restroom. As soon as he leaves, a couple of creeps walk into the bar and start harassing you in not so subtle ways. The bartender doesn’t seem to react, so you’re left to handle the situation yourself. Don’t Whack Your Teacher!! Never. Really!
Don’t Whack Your Teacher is part of a genre of games that are really just there to either be funny or allow people to vent frustrations. The problem is that this game might seriously disturb some people and contains brutal depictions of violence in a setting that might be sensitive to the public. The style of the artwork in the game is nice. The animations, however, are jumpy and crude. There is a single classic background song going while you play.
